Saying "Me three" is a humorous play on words, as if "Me too" were misunderstood as "Me two" and to be thus followed up with "Me three," "Me four," and so on. But "Me three" can be understood to really mean "Me too," or "Me also."
The word "too" is different from the word "to" and "two" . The meaning of "too" would mean also. It could also mean "too" much. These are some examples: It's too hot! or Can I come too?
